Where is Expedia USA headquarters?

Seattle, Washington
Expedia Group

Expedia Group’s headquarters in Seattle, Washington
Founded October 22, 1996 (as a division of Microsoft)
Founder Rich Barton
Headquarters Seattle, Washington, U.S.
Key people Barry Diller (Chairman) Peter Kern (CEO)

Does Expedia have offices?

Expedia Group is headquartered in Bellevue, WA and has 12 offices located throughout the US.

How do I contact Expedia headquarters?

Here’s how you can contact us about your specific request: You can call us at (877) 227-7481.

Where is Expedia based?

Expedia Inc. is an online travel agency owned by Expedia Group, an American online travel shopping company based in Seattle. The website and mobile app can be used to book airline tickets, hotel reservations, car rentals, cruise ships, and vacation packages.

Who is the CEO of Expedia?

Peter Kern
Peter Kern became chief executive officer of Expedia EXPE 3.59% Group Inc. last April, during the travel industry’s worst crisis in decades.

Is Expedia owned by Microsoft?

Following the initial public offering, Expedia, Inc. will become a separate company, but will have a contractual relationship with and be majority-owned by Microsoft®. As part of the contractual relationship, Expedia, Inc. will continue to provide Travel travel services on the MSN.

How do I speak with someone at Expedia?

You can call us at (877) 227-7481.

How do I get a live person on Expedia?

If you need to talk to a live person in Expedia customer service you need to dial 1-800-397-3342 phone number.

Which is better booking com or Expedia?

Over the last 10 years, Booking Holdings has delivered greater revenue growth than Expedia, as well as greater earnings-per-share growth. Delivering superior EPS growth is easy when a company is significantly more profitable.

Is Expedia still owned by Microsoft?

How do you contact Expedia by phone?

If you need to contact Expedia’s customer service to make changes to your itinerary or for any other reason, there are several ways to do so. Contact customer support at Expedia by calling 800-397-3342. The number is toll-free and operators are available 24 hours a day.

What are Expedia customer service hours?

For all your travel needs, the Expedia customer services is accessible at the Expedia contact phone number UK 0330 123 1235 or +44 289 044 4609 when calling from outside the UK. The Expedia phone opening hours are from Mon- Fri 8AM- 10PM and Sat- Sun 9AM- 10PM.

Can you email Expedia?

Visit the Expedia website (expedia.com) to send an email to Expedia. Click on the “Customer Support” link at the top of the page and click on “Send Us An Email” under the “Three Ways to Find Answers” link.